Grass-shrub Vegetation Protection on Red Sandstone Engineering Slope in Shaoguan-Ganzhou Expressway
Four typical sections of red sandstone slope along Shaoguan-Ganzhou expressway were selected tostudy the ecological protective effects of the grass-shrub vegetation technology on protection of red sandstoneslope.Plots were deployed to investigate the species compositions with different grass-shrub ratio.In addition
the number
height and frequency of shrub were also surveyed and recorded.The indexes regarding relative abundance
relative height
relative frequency
important value of plots
the shrubs were determined todescribe the compositional features and quantitative and ecological characteristics of the plant communities inthe test area.The results indicated that grass-shrub vegetation technology was more readily adaptable for redsandstone with poor surface soil
which is prone to weathering and erosion.Legume species grow well in thecircumstance with pool soil by nitrogen fixation and therefore played an important role in ecological restoration of vegetation on the study area.A certain ratio of local native shrubs
legume and grass could build astable plant community on red sandstone slope
